How To Choose The Best Comforter Sets

Most bedding purchases fail not because of the color, but because of the sheet-to-comforter relationship: the fitted sheet is too shallow, the fabric pills within weeks, or the fill clumps into cold spots. Paying attention to three specific specs eliminates those outcomes.

Fabric Weight & Fill Density

Fabric weight determines how the set feels against skin and how it breathes. Sets listing a specific GSM number — around 270 GSM for the fill — indicate a denser down-alternative that resists clumping. Plain-woven microfiber under 90 GSM feels airy but may sheer over time; brushed microfiber at higher densities gives that silky drape without the heat trap of pure polyester batting.

Fitted Sheet Pocket Depth

A fitted sheet with a 14-inch pocket will fit standard mattresses cleanly, but modern pillow-top or memory foam mattresses often exceed that depth. Look for a minimum 14-inch pocket on paper, and preferably a 16-inch pocket if your mattress top is taller than 12 inches. Sheets that measure exactly 14 inches but stretch thin are the top cause of corner pop-offs during sleep.

Piece Count & Functional Value

Five-piece sets (comforter, flat sheet, fitted sheet, sham, pillowcase) cover the basics without extra fabric to launder. Seven- or eight-piece sets add a second pillowcase or a decorative cushion cover, which matters if you style the bed with accent pillows or host guests who need matching pillowcases. More pieces do not mean better quality — examine each component’s material independently.

FAQ

How do I wash a comforter set without ruining the fill?
Most microfiber comforter sets should be washed on a cold, gentle cycle with a mild detergent. Do not use bleach or fabric softener — softener coats the fibers and reduces fluff. Tumble dry on low heat. For vacuum-packed comforters, run a 20-minute low-heat dry cycle with a clean tennis ball before first use to break up clumps and restore loft.
What is the ideal fitted sheet pocket depth for a full mattress?
For a standard full mattress (around 54 inches wide), a fitted sheet pocket of 14 inches works for thicknesses up to 12 inches. If your mattress includes a pillow-top or memory foam topper that pushes total height past 13 inches, opt for a set with a 16-inch pocket. The DJY set offers 16-inch pockets, while most others in this list provide 14 inches.
Can I use a queen comforter on a full bed?
Yes — a queen comforter (typically 86×86 inches or 90×90 inches) will drape over a full mattress with extra drop on the sides and foot. This is common if you want a more generous, hotel-style look. Just note that the sheets and fitted sheet in a “bed in a bag” set are size-specific, so buying a queen set for a full bed may leave you with oversize sheets that bunch or tuck poorly.
